The Columbia River Tribes have stewarded Pacific lamprey for thousands of years, long before dams and pollution altered our rivers and pushed this ancient fish toward the margins.This week, Metro and the Oregon Zoo joined the Columbia River Inter-Tribal Fish Commission to return this year’s cohort to the Breitenbush River. Tribal-led biology and science is driving this conservation work. We are honored to support it.Pacific lamprey are 450 million years old, older than dinosaurs, older than trees. Today, Metro Council approved over $26 million in parks and nature investments, funding 51 projects across greater Portland.Nature is what makes our region special. Ask people what they love most about living here, and they say “nature,” not just the wild places far away, but the nature we get to enjoy close to home.This funding comes from the Parks and Nature bond voters approved in 2019, and so much of it was shaped by community members themselves: neighbors who voted on which projects to fund, organizers who brought culture and healing into these spaces, residents who showed up to protect the land they call home. Our Community Choice Grants process was one of the largest participatory budgeting cycles in the country, proof that when we trust communities to lead, they deliver.I’m proud to keep this work going as your Metro Council President. The Dolores is open in Hillsboro, and 67 affordable homes now have families in them, real people who can finally afford to live in the region they work and raise their kids in.We didn’t get there by accident either. Metro used dollars from our affordable housing bond, which is on track to deliver more than 5,600 homes region-wide, our site-acquisition program, which identifies the best locations for dense, affordable housing before land gets too expensive to build on, and 20 long-term rent vouchers through Supportive Housing Services for people experiencing extreme poverty. Three tools, working together, to make sure this housing actually stays affordable for the people who need it most.Thank you to Hacienda CDC, the City of Hillsboro, and Washington County for building this with us.As your Metro Council President, I will keep working to fix the most pressing issues our region is facing. I toured Fora Health to see our behavioral health and recovery system up close. This is what it looks like when people get the support they need to exit homelessness for good.Oregon ranks near the bottom nationally for behavioral health and recovery access. In Multnomah County, 372 people died while experiencing homelessness in 2024, and unintentional overdose was the leading cause. These numbers are a policy choice that I am not comfortable accepting.Recovery and transitional shelter is one of the biggest gaps in our system. We don’t have enough beds for people who need intensive support, especially those managing substance use and behavioral health conditions at the same time. That’s why we’re coordinating investments across our three counties to close that gap.This is hard work, and it’s not fast. But it’s the work.
